A Dickens of a Christmas

Christmas Carol
Literary Arts
Theater

Charles Dickens (as impersonated by Roger Jerome) hosts a Victorian family party where he briefly tells the story of A Christmas Carol, sings the song "Shiverandshakery," and performs magic tricks. This is an interactive performance with students acting parts and singing along.

Availability: start time of 10 am or later
Recommended Ages: Grades K-12
Maximum Audience: 300
Length: 40 minutes
Cost: $550 first session/$200 each additional
Limit No. Sessions: 2


Technical Needs

  • Artist Arrival: 90 minutes prior to the performance
  • Organization representative should meet the artist and show him to the presentation area.
  • Two adults or four students needed to assist with unloading equipment.
  • The artist would like an organization representative to introduce him as Charles Dickens.
  • Audience participation: pre-select 3-6 students (including one who is diminutive in size) as participants in the performance.
  • There is a Question and Answer session following the presentation, which is not included in running time.
  • Equipment needed by artist: access to electrical outlets, a table, and a chair or stool.
  • At least 20 members of the audiences should bring outdoor coats, scarves, hats, etc.
  • Large gathering space is suitable for this presentation. Minimum amount of space needed for presentation: 15' x 15'
  • Please provide drinking water for the artist.
